I have question about Quarterly branch commits. Committers Guide says at 19.6.2 (https://www.freebsd.org/doc/en/articles/committers-guide/ports.html#ports-qa-blanket):
==== The following blanket approvals are in effect: ... * Fixing shebangs, stripping installed libraries and binaries, and plist fixes. ... Important: No unauthorized commits can ever be made without approval of either Ports Security Team <ports-sect...@freebsd.org> or Ports Management Team <port...@freebsd.org>. ==== I see contradiction here. Are such changes are pre-approved ("blanket approvals") or approval must be requested & gained? Other question, whom should I ask for approval? I was said, that "portmgr is not responsible for approving merges, or direct commits, to the quarterly branches." in private message. Must shebang fix be approved by ports-secteam@?
